About the surrounding area of Holt HideawayFor an adventure in the great outdoors, Norfolk is an absolute must, as the driest county in the UK! The whole county is about enjoyment of the fresh air, big skies and absolutely stunning views, and is home to Britain's largest protected wetland, nature reserves of international importance, and over 90 miles of unspoilt, award-winning coastline!
Holt is a stunning town home to art galleries, antique and book shops and delicious eateries, with a maze of 18th century Georgian buildings hiding delightful courtyards and alleyways!

And for hiking, look no further. Stretching from Holme-next-the-Sea all the way to Cromer, the 45-mile long Norfolk Coastal Path through this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ty offers some of the best birdwatching in the UK, a glimpse of the seals on Blakeney Point, and the earliest evidence of humans found outside The Great Rift Valley in Africa on the Deep History Coast! The path weaves itself through tidal creeks and salt marshes, shingle, luscious fields and enormous sandy beaches – and as Norfolk is a haven for wildlife and birds, you’ll have plenty to admire throughout!

Region
Found in the East of England, Norfolk’s charms are as broad as the famous network of rivers that run through it. With an abundance of natural beauty and wildlife, this is one county where you can really kick back and enjoy some quintessential English countryside.
